  • Association of Genes in the NF-kappa B Pathway with Antibody-Positive Primary Sjogren's Syndrome

    • Primary Sjogren's syndrome (SS) is a systemic autoimmune inflammatory disease characterized by focal lymphocytic infiltrates in the lachrymal and salivary glands and autoantibodies against the SSA/Ro and SSB/La antigens. Experimental studies have shown an activation of NF-B in primary SS. NF-B activation results in inflammation and autoimmunity and is regulated by inhibitory and activating proteins. Genetic studies have shown an association between multiple autoimmune diseases and TNFAIP3 (A20) and TNIP1 (ABIN1), both repressors of NF-B and of IKBKE (IKK epsilon), which is an NF-B activator. The aim of this study was to analyse single nucleotide polymorphisms (SNPs) in the IKBKE, NFKB1, TNIP1 and TNFAIP3 genes for association with primary SS. A total of 12 SNPs were genotyped in 1105 patients from Scandinavia (Sweden and Norway, n=684) and the UK (n=421) and 4460 controls (Scandinavia, n=1662, UK, n=2798). When patients were stratified for the presence of anti-SSA and/or anti-SSB antibodies (n=868), case-control meta-analysis found an association between antibody-positive primary SS and two SNPs in TNIP1 (P=3.4x10(-5), OR=1.33, 95%CI: 1.16-1.52 for rs3792783 and P=1.3x10(-3), OR=1.21, 95%CI: 1.08-1.36 for rs7708392). A TNIP1 risk haplotype was associated with antibody-positive primary SS (P=5.7x10(-3), OR=1.47, 95%CI: 1.12-1.92). There were no significant associations with IKBKE, NFKB1 or TNFAIP3 in the meta-analysis of the Scandinavian and UK cohorts. We conclude that polymorphisms in TNIP1 are associated with antibody-positive primary SS.

  • Complement Opsonization Promotes Herpes Simplex Virus 2 Infection of Human Dendritic Cells

    • Herpes simplex virus 2 (HSV-2) is one of the most common sexually transmitted infections globally, with a very high prevalence in many countries. During HSV-2 infection, viral particles become coated with complement proteins and antibodies, both present in genital fluids, which could influence the activation of immune responses. In genital mucosa, the primary target cells for HSV-2 infection are epithelial cells, but resident immune cells, such as dendritic cells (DCs), are also infected. DCs are the activators of the ensuing immune responses directed against HSV-2, and the aim of this study was to examine the effects opsonization of HSV-2, either with complement alone or with complement and antibodies, had on the infection of immature DCs and their ability to mount inflammatory and antiviral responses. Complement opsonization of HSV-2 enhanced both the direct infection of immature DCs and their production of new infectious viral particles. The enhanced infection required activation of the complement cascade and functional complement receptor 3. Furthermore, HSV-2 infection of DCs required endocytosis of viral particles and their delivery into an acid endosomal compartment. The presence of complement in combination with HSV-1- or HSV-2-specific antibodies more or less abolished HSV-2 infection of DCs. Our results clearly demonstrate the importance of studying HSV-2 infection under conditions that ensue in vivo, i.e., conditions under which the virions are covered in complement fragments and complement fragments and antibodies, as these shape the infection and the subsequent immune response and need to be further elucidated.   • LOW-DOSE BELIMUMAB AND ANTIMALARIAL AGENTS PREVENT RENAL FLARES IN SYSTEMIC LUPUS ERYTHEMATOSUS : RESULTS FROM FOUR RANDOMISED CLINICAL TRIALS

    • Background: Lupus nephritis (LN) is one of the most severe manifestations in systemic lupus erythematosus (SLE), constituting a substantial cause of end-stage kidney disease, dialysis, and mortality. Prompt and adequate treatment of LN, and prevention of renal flares are key components of disease management towards improved outcomes in patients with SLE.Objectives: We aimed to determine the effect of the use of antimalarial agents (AMA) and different doses and pharmaceutical forms of belimumab on preventing renal flares in patients with active SLE.Methods: We pooled data from the BLISS-52, BLISS-76, BLISS-SC and BLISS-Northeast Asia randomised clinical trials of belimumab (N=3225), that included patients with seropositive (antinuclear antibody titres ≥1:80 and/or anti-dsDNA levels ≥30 IU/mL), active SLE yet no severe ongoing renal disease. Participants were allocated to receive intravenous (IV) belimumab 1 mg/kg (N=559), IV belimumab 10 mg/kg (N=1033), subcutaneous (SC) belimumab 200 mg (N=556) or placebo (N=1077) in addition to standard therapy. Additionally, we classified patients as AMA users if they had received hydroxychloroquine, chloroquine, mepacrine, or quinine sulphate in stable doses for at least 30 days prior to the trial commencement. The outcome of the present post-hoc analysis was development of renal flares, defined according to the analysis plan within the BLISS programme. The hazard of renal flare was assessed with Cox proportional hazards regression models, adjusted for age, sex, ethnicity, previous renal involvement, baseline proteinuria and glomerular filtration rate, and use of glucocorticoids and immunosuppressants.Results: In total, 192 patients developed a renal flare after a median of 197 days. In multivariable Cox regression analysis, use of AMA was associated with a lower risk of renal flares (HR: 0.64; 95% CI: 0.54–0.96; p=0.026). Compared with placebo, the risk of renal flares was lower among patients receiving IV belimumab 1 mg/kg (HR: 0.44; 95% CI: 0.25–0.79; p=0.006) and IV belimumab 10 mg/kg (HR: 0.63; 95% CI: 0.45–0.87; p=0.005), but not SC belimumab 200 mg (HR: 0.90; 95% CI: 0.57–1.42; p=0.648). When analysing all study arms with and without antimalarials separately, patients receiving IV belimumab 1 mg/kg along with AMA experienced the lowest rate of renal flares (18.5 (7.4–38.1) cases per 1000 person-years). Using patients who received placebo but not AMA as the reference comparator, patients receiving IV belimumab 1 mg/kg (OR: 0.30; 95% CI: 0.13–0.70; p=0.005) and patients receiving IV belimumab 10 mg (OR: 0.45; 95% CI: 0.27–0.75; p=0.002) were protected against renal flares only when belimumab use was combined with AMA.Conclusion: In this RCT setting, belimumab and AMA protected against renal flares in patients with active seropositive SLE yet no ongoing severe renal involvement. The protective effect of IV belimumab against renal flares appeared optimal when belimumab was combined with AMA. The prominent effect of low-dose belimumab motivates investigation of the efficacy of intermediate doses of belimumab.
